CHANGELOG view
@@ -1,3 +1,23 @@+git-annex (10.20240531) upstream; urgency=medium++  * git-remote-annex: New program which allows pushing a git repo to a+    git-annex special remote, and cloning from a special remote.+    (Based on Michael Hanke's git-remote-datalad-annex.)+  * initremote, enableremote: Added --with-url to enable using+    git-remote-annex.+  * When building an adjusted unlocked branch, make pointer files+    executable when the annex object file is executable.+  * group: Added --list option.+  * fsck: Fix recent reversion that made it say it was checksumming files+    whose content is not present.+  * Avoid the --fast option preventing checksumming in some cases it+    was not supposed to.+  * testremote: Really fsck downloaded objects.+  * Typo fixes.+    Thanks, Yaroslav Halchenko++ -- Joey Hess <id@joeyh.name>  Fri, 31 May 2024 12:32:29 -0400+ git-annex (10.20240430) upstream; urgency=medium    * Bug fix: While redundant concurrent transfers were already@@ -4576,7 +4596,7 @@     --clean-duplicates mode, verify that enough copies of its content still     exist.   * Improve integration with KDE's file manager to work with dolphin-    version 14.12.3 while still being compatable with 4.14.2.+    version 14.12.3 while still being compatible with 4.14.2.
